The Beauty of Real Diamonds—Without the Mining
Let’s clear this up right away: lab-grown diamonds are real diamonds.
They share the same chemical composition, structure, fire, brilliance, and durability. The only difference is their origin. Instead of forming deep underground over millions of years, they are grown in controlled laboratory environments using advanced technology that replicates Earth’s natural processes.

How to Choose a Lab-Grown Diamond This Holiday Season
If you’re exploring this option for the first time, here’s what to keep in mind:
Know your 4 Cs
Just like mined diamonds, cut, color, clarity, and carat affect the value and look of lab-grown diamonds.
Choose a jeweler who is transparent
You want clear grading reports, certified stones, and a jeweler willing to answer your questions openly. This ensures quality—and peace of mind.
